PHOENIX — U.S. Sen. Ruben Gallego of Arizona was disgusted to hear that the Pentagon is investigating his colleague for urging military members to not follow illegal orders.
“These are the things that we should be very mad about, we should be very scared about,” Gallego told KTAR News 92.3 FM’s Outspoken with Bruce & Gaydos on Monday. “We should not allow a president to do this type of weaponization.”
He spoke in support of fellow Democratic U.S. Sen. Mark Kelly, a former Navy pilot who is the target of a federal probe.
Ruben Gallego condemns Pentagon for investigating Mark Kelly
The Department of War said Monday on X that it is reviewing “serious allegations of misconduct” against Kelly. Officials cited a federal statute barring interference with military loyalty, morale, or discipline, noting that Kelly could face court-martial proceedings.
“This is bad, right?” Gallego said. “Like, this president is going after a sitting elected official — doesn’t matter if a Democrat or Republican — using his service as a weapon to try to silence him.”
The probe stems from a video released last week by Kelly and five other Democrats, urging military and intelligence personnel to not obey illegal orders from their superiors.
In response, President Donald Trump denounced the video as “seditious behavior, punishable by death.” Over the weekend, Kelly said he and the others involved have faced increased threats following Trump’s remarks.
That’s unacceptable to Ruben Gallego, a former U.S. Marine.
“The most important thing to understand is that anyone that serves in the military, you take an oath, right? You take an oath to the Constitution of the United States,” Gallego said. “The fact that these Democrats are and veterans are restating what is already known for somehow is threatening to this president tells you a lot about what he how he thinks about the military.”
